Trains Newswire today reports that HSR Authority has come to terms for providing a large amount of financing for the planned thru track layout at Union Station. It is stated that the deal will, of course, provide space for HSR tracks. Does anyone know how many station tracks/platforms they will get? I know space is tight.
 
Link Union Station Final Environmental Impact Report - June 2019

It's 1562 pages in total and a little confusing as it shows changes from the earlier draft. Looking at it, it shows 10 thru tracks (ultimately, the document suggest some staging in the construction), and one or two platforms and two or four station tracks for HSR (and it seems to suggest some of that work will be done separately from this project). All the tracks, at least in the station area, seem to be at the same grade. The only viaduct looks to be the one that will carry the 10 thru tracks over the road to the south of the station. The project also includes re-configuring the throat and approach tracks north of the station.
